How 7 Times get you to 1914 – The End of the Gentile Times

“Hew down the tree. . . leave the stump of his roots in the earth, even with a band of iron and brass . . . let a beast’s heart be given unto him; and let seven times pass over him” – Daniel 4:14-16

This text comes from a dream of Nebuchadnezzar, king of Babylon. Many things occur in dreams which are impossible in reality. That was true in this dream. Nebuchadnezzar saw a great tree which sheltered and nourished all the beasts of earth and fowl of heaven. “The height thereof reached unto heaven, and the sight thereof to the end of all the earth.” Suddenly this majestic tree was ordered of the angels to be hewn down, but to leave the “stump of his roots in the earth, . . .  with a band of iron and brass.” (Dan. 4:10-15) The scene changed, and the tree became a man given over to the life of a beast. “Wet with the dew of heaven . . . let his portion be with the beasts in the grass of the earth: let his heart be changed from man’s and let a beast’s heart be given unto him; and let seven times pass over him.” (Vs. 15, 16)
